Conditional formatting for the background

Hi,

 

1.I have a threshold value say 1, if the value are falling <1 the background should be in red and if the value falls >1 the background should turn green.

2.And is there any option of showing an indicator kind of symbol for the value that comes.

3.Finally according to my values both the background and the indicator should work dynamically.

@Vaishnavi_M Currently in power bi conditional formatting is only allowed for tables, see this link. So you wont be able to have conditional formatting background for the visual. KPI visual can be a good alternative to your requirement of showing up or down arrow.
